Floating Island

Floating-island.
Photo credit: spatuladesserts.com

Also known as île flottante in French, a floating island is a light, fluffy, and creamy classic French dessert that is, in fact, no-bake and super easy. Made with milk, sugar, egg, and vanilla, the floating island dessert isn’t just simple to make but also gluten-free! Top it with your favorite garnish, such as nuts, caramel, chocolate, or fruit, and you’ll have an elegant, eye-catching sweet treat guaranteed to be a crowd-pleaser.

Panna Cotta

passion fruit panna cotta with one bite missing
Photo credit: spatuladesserts.com

Panna cotta means “cooked cream” in Italian, and this European dessert is incredibly versatile. It is a molded dessert of sweetened cream thickened and set with gelatin to make the texture stable yet still jiggly.  It can be flavored in so many ways, from coffee, coconut, vanilla, or other fruit. This particular Panna cotta recipe is made with coconut milk, so it is, in fact, a dairy-free European dessert.
